Watertown, Sd vs Sheberghan Climate & Distance Between

Afghanistan flag
  • The distance between Watertown, Sd, Usa and Sheberghan, Afghanistan is approximately 10,770 km or 6,692 mi.
  • To reach Watertown, Sd in this distance one would set out from Sheberghan bearing 347.8°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Watertown, Sd bearing 193.9° or SSW .
  • Watertown, Sd has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Sheberghan has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
  • Watertown, Sd is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Sheberghan is in or near the warm temperate desert scrub bi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 10.5 °C (18.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.2 °C (9.4°F) more in Watertown, Sd. The continentality subtype is truly continental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 334.2 mm (13.2 in) more which is equivalent to 334.2 l/m² (8.2 US gal/ft²) or 3,342,000 l/ha (357,282 US gal/ac) more. About 2 4/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.3° lower in Watertown, Sd than in Sheberghan.
